Comprehending Online Tests
Online tests refer to assessments administered through the web, encompassing a variety of formats that vary from multiple-choice concerns to complicated simulations. They can be utilized for instructional assessments, professional accreditations, or perhaps casual self-assessments.

For institutions thinking about the shift to online testing, a number of finest practices can assist guarantee an effective application:
Choose the Right Platform:
Evaluate various online testing platforms based on functions, ease of use, security, and assistance.
Incorporate Security Measures:
Use proctoring services, monitoring software application, and secure web browsers to reduce unfaithful threats.
Provide Clear Instructions:
Ensure that test-takers have extensive guidelines on how to navigate the online platform.
Pilot Before Going Live:
Conduct a trial run with a little group to identify prospective concerns before the full implementation.
Train Educators and Administrators:
